The Language Police
I have just finished reading a book titled "The Language Police: How Pressure Groups Restrict What Students Learn" by Diane Ravitch that takes to task textbook and testing companies who acquiesce to left-wing and right-wing pressure groups to censor and bowdlerize the materials that they give K-12 students. Dr. Ravitch is an educator and historian who presents an eloquent and convincing exposé of what these pressure groups and companies are doing and she also has solutions that seem workable.

Dr Ravitch has also included a reading list for grades 3-10 that is wide ranging and will give the reader a well rounded liberal arts background. Most adult readers would also be well served if they were to follow the recommendations on this list.
